Therefore, Chen Wenzhe imitated a Ming Dynasty Xuande doucai plate with a mandarin duck and lotus pond pattern!
This plate has a diameter of 21.5 cm, a full diameter of 13.3 cm and a height of 4.2 cm.
The mouth is curved, the wall is curved, the short feet are slightly convergent, and the bottom is slightly concave.
There is a Tibetan auspicious sutra in blue and white along the inner mouth. The main idea is: "Peace during the day and peace at night. Peace at noon during the day. Peace for a long time day and night. The Three Treasures bless you peace and tranquility."
Using Tibetan religious blessings as decoration on porcelain can be said to be unconventional.
The heart of the pan is painted with three groups of red lotuses using the boneless method, interspersed with reeds, red polygonum, arrowheads, duckweed, etc.
The mandarin ducks are outlined with blue flowers, and their feathers are painted in red, purple and yellow.
The outer wall is painted with four groups of red lotuses and decorated with red polygonum, arrowheads, and two pairs of mandarin ducks interspersed between them. There are six characters in two lines and two circles on the bottom.

Ming Dynasty Xuande red-glazed gold bell bowl. The red glaze is originally Xuande's exquisite product, especially the ruby red glaze porcelain, not to mention this is a gold bell bowl.
The diameter of this bowl is 13.5 cm, the foot diameter is 8.1 cm, and the height is 10.4 cm.
The authentic product was unearthed in the Xuande Formation of Zhushan Mountain in 1993. It has a wide mouth, a deep belly, an arc wall and a shallow circle foot.
The whole body is covered with red glaze, without any decoration, and the inside of the bowl is covered with white glaze. On the center of the bowl is the inscription "Made in the Xuande Year of the Great Ming Dynasty" with six characters in two lines and two circles.
